Which equipment would be most appropriate for creating dramatic light effects in theatre?

Luminaire

Neutral Density Filter

Parcan

The Parcan, or Parabolic Aluminized Reflector Can, is highly effective in creating dramatic lighting effects in theatre due to its versatility and strong, focused beam of light. It is specifically designed for theatrical applications, offering a variety of color options and the ability to create different angles of light, which can enhance the mood and atmosphere of a production. Its simple design allows for easy modification and positioning, making it a favorite for lighting designers seeking to achieve dynamic effects on stage.

While other equipment like luminaires and filters play important roles in lighting design, they may serve different purposes. Luminaires comprise a broad category of light fixtures that can range from very general to highly specialized options, whereas neutral density filters primarily reduce light intensity without affecting color, which might not serve the goal of creating dramatic effects directly. A moon box, typically used to mimic moonlight, has a specific application and may not provide the flexibility or impact that a Parcan does for dramatic staging.
